Linq не может найти вставленную запись перед отправкой изменений

У меня есть этот фрагмент кода:

LinqDataContext ctx;

MyRecord R = new MyRecord();
R.Title = "test";
ctx.AllRecords.InsertOnSubmit(R);

bool bExists = ctx.AllRecords.Any(r => r.Title == "test");

Примечание: я не вызывал SubmitChanges.

Почему bExists возвращается как ложное? Разве Linq не может видеть вставленную запись?

8
задан Jack 5 January 2012 в 03:34
поделиться